Clarifications

  • No decision has been made
  • If this proposal is approved:
  • the beach would not be sold
  • the courts would be:

available for public permits and use installed without fencing paid for by the Niagara Rapids

  • Maintenance costs offset by permit fees
  • the courts would not delay the installation of

a splash pad in the north-end

What we’ve heard so far

  • Too close to the houses
  • Too far from the washrooms
  • Take up the part of the beach:
  • with shade
  • near the playground
  • that is quiet and away from the sea-doos,

boats, etc.

The courts would be in a bad location because they are:

Planned Next Steps*

Feb 22: Submit comments to City by this date Late March/April: Staff report published in advance of City Council meeting April: City Council reviews proposal

* Schedule subject to change.
